Summary Job Description | Tasks | |||
Devise methods to improve oil and gas extraction and production and determine the need for new or modified tool designs. Oversee drilling and offer technical advice. | Assess costs and estimate the production capabilities and economic value of oil and gas wells, to evaluate the economic viability of potential drilling sites. | |||
| ||||
Monitor production rates, and plan rework processes to improve production. | ||||
| ||||
Analyze data to recommend placement of wells and supplementary processes to enhance production. | ||||
| ||||
Specify and supervise well modification and stimulation programs to maximize oil and gas recovery. | ||||
| ||||
Direct and monitor the completion and evaluation of wells, well testing, or well surveys. | ||||
| ||||
Assist engineering and other personnel to solve operating problems. | ||||
| ||||
Develop plans for oil and gas field drilling, and for product recovery and treatment. | ||||
| ||||
Maintain records of drilling and production operations. | ||||
| ||||
Confer with scientific, engineering, and technical personnel to resolve design, research, and testing problems. | ||||
| ||||
Write technical reports for engineering and management personnel. | ||||
| ||||
Evaluate findings to develop, design, or test equipment or processes. | ||||
| ||||
Assign work to staff to obtain maximum utilization of personnel. | ||||
| ||||
Interpret drilling and testing information for personnel. | ||||
| ||||
Design and implement environmental controls on oil and gas operations. | ||||
| ||||
Coordinate the installation, maintenance, and operation of mining and oil field equipment. | ||||
| ||||
Supervise the removal of drilling equipment, the removal of any waste, and the safe return of land to structural stability when wells or pockets are exhausted. | ||||
| ||||
Inspect oil and gas wells to determine that installations are completed. | ||||
| ||||
Simulate reservoir performance for different recovery techniques, using computer models. | ||||
| ||||
Take samples to assess the amount and quality of oil, the depth at which resources lie, and the equipment needed to properly extract them. | ||||
| ||||
Coordinate activities of workers engaged in research, planning, and development. | ||||
| ||||
Design or modify mining and oil field machinery and tools, applying engineering principles. | ||||
| ||||
Test machinery and equipment to ensure that it is safe and conforms to performance specifications. | ||||
| ||||
Conduct engineering research experiments to improve or modify mining and oil machinery and operations. | ||||
